The key difference between coagulation and flocculation in water treatment is that the coagulation is a chemical process while flocculation is a physical process. First process in drinking water treatment coagulation is to destabilize the particles and allow them the potential to collide and stick together.

Coagulation involves the use of a coagulant which has the potential to de-stabilize the previously stabilized charged particles in the suspension. In contrast in flocculation the de-stabilization is brought about by physical techniques such as mixing of the solution and also sometimes by the addition of polymers. Flocculation is used in water treatment plants along with coagulation techniques in order to remove suspended particles in water.
